Subj : src/sexpots/sexpots.c To : Git commit to main/sbbs/master From : Rob Swindell (on Windows 11) Date : Fri Nov 22 2024 18:05:08 https://gitlab.synchro.net/main/sbbs/-/commit/e2bcf7223ea3817ac6ae4d9d Modified Files: src/sexpots/sexpots.c Log Message: If configured COM port byte size is less than 8, strip high 8-n bits on RX Some USB modems (reportedly, USRobotics USB modem) don't strip the parity bit of data received from modem connections operating in < 8 bit modes (e.g. 7-E-1), as is normally don't with a modem connected to a UART, so we'll do that stripping (forcing to 0) here, as recommended by Deuce.
